A solution to meningiomas at the trigone of the lateral ventricle using a contralateral transfalcine approach.

Abstract

BACKGROUND: Access to the trigone of the lateral ventricle is challenging because of the deep location and the intimate relationships to eloquent areas.
METHODS: A novel posterior interhemispheric transfalx transprecuneus approach for two meningiomas at the trigone of the lateral ventricle is described.
RESULTS: The meningiomas were resected completely with good neurologic outcomes and no operative mortality.
CONCLUSIONS: The feasibilities and advantages of this novel approach are discussed.
